Job Description

What You'll Do

Commitment to manage the department for growth with a strong emphasis on technical work execution and business development
Lead and mentor a team of geotechnical engineers and project managers
Oversee geotechnical and field services projects
Prepare and review reports
Prepare proposals for geotechnical engineering services
Manage departmental P&L
Assist senior staff in marketing ECS services by maintaining regular client contact

What We're Looking For

BS or MS in Civil Engineering or Geological Engineering from an ABET accredited college/university; MSCE with geotechnical emphasis preferred

10-12 years of civil/geotechnical engineering experience

Professional Engineer (PE) license or ability to obtain one within three months

Who We Are

Founded in 1988, Engineering Consulting Services (ECS) is a leader in geotechnical, construction materials, environmental, and facilities engineering. ECS is currently ranked 2 in Zweig Group's Hot Firms List (Zweig Group, June 2023), 61 in Engineering News-Record's Top 500 Design Firms (ENR, April 2023), and 131 in Engineering News-Record's Top 200 Environmental Firms (ENR, July 2023).
